    can you select the order you golf balls will be put in play if you run out of balls you are using? in other words I use white rzn balls and want to use rzn red balls if i run out during play of the rzn balls instead of reverting to the standard wgt balls you are given?

    if u run out of selected balls during play then u will be given a free WGT rock to continue. However on start up u are always given the choice of buying more balls if u are on ur last ball of that or any type.

    No. There are no players' options during ranked / rated play. You'd have to buy some before you fall back to the Starter ball.

    hobbles61:

    can you select the order you golf balls will be put in play if you run out of balls you are using? 

    No.

    WGT provides notification you are down to the last ball of that make/model, and the notification gives you the opportunity to get one or more sleeves of the same ball.

    WGT is set up such that a make/model of ball different from the ball a game was started with can not be put into play mid-game. The lone exception is the free Starter ball WGT substitutes so you can finish the game in progress.

    There is a Local Rule: Conditions of the Competition tournament committees can adopt known as the One Ball Condition that is covered in Appendix 1, Part C, 1., c. in the USGA Rules of Golf book.

    WGT is the tournament committee here, and has modeled the Conditions of the Competition similar to the One Ball Condition.
